Output cfb0b858646c8f880d39cac72b6e32e340218c1e95b65e9ae7d560b6361b6e41:5

value
2437886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ec200bff1ae773864f9577bc2f46beb10cc3b451 OP_EQUAL
address
3PDXnUFftnVdU2BMXCKaoyFZbHSADqkSBm
transaction
cfb0b858646c8f880d39cac72b6e32e340218c1e95b65e9ae7d560b6361b6e41
confirmations
239164
spent
true